The Evolution of Search Behavior
For the past twenty years, the digital discovery funnel has remained largely static. Users seeking information entered queries into search engines, navigated through a list of ten results, and manually synthesized data from multiple websites. This behavior defined the multi-billion-dollar SEO industry, which focused on link-building, meta-data optimization, and keyword density.
However, the rapid adoption of large language models (LLMs) has disrupted this cycle. Data indicates that ChatGPT reached 100 million active users in just two months, and by early 2025, it was processing over 10 million web-browsing queries daily. This transition toward conversational search is further cemented by Google’s integration of AI-generated responses, known as AI Mode, now accessible to users in over 180 countries. As of Q1 2025, Google reported that AI-integrated features contributed to a 10% increase in search revenue, totaling $50.7 billion, confirming that the move toward AI-driven answers is not a temporary trend but a core component of the future search economy.
Defining AIO and Its Technical Requirements
AI Optimization differs from traditional SEO in its fundamental mechanics. While SEO focuses on signals such as domain authority, page load speeds, and backlink volume, AIO prioritizes the capability of an AI model to extract, summarize, and verify information. LLMs function based on probabilistic reasoning and the retrieval of high-confidence data. Consequently, content that succeeds in AIO is often characterized by technical structure, data-driven insights, and factual precision.
Experts in the field note that AIO is not a replacement for SEO but a necessary expansion of it. A website may maintain high traditional search rankings while remaining invisible to AI models if the content lacks the structural markers—such as schema markup, conversational query alignment, and verified statistical data—required for LLMs to confidently cite the source as an authority.
Strategic Tactics for AI Visibility
To navigate this new environment, content creators are adopting a series of seven proven strategies designed to maximize the likelihood of AI citation:
- Data-Backed Content: AI models demonstrate a preference for verifiable, quantitative information. Grounding claims in specific statistics and peer-reviewed data increases the model’s "confidence score" in a particular source.
- Community Engagement: Authentic participation in platforms like Reddit and Quora allows AI models to encounter brand mentions within high-value, human-curated datasets.
- Conversational Query Optimization: Moving beyond short-tail keywords, creators are now optimizing for natural language, structured as full-sentence questions that mirror how users interact with voice and chat assistants.
- Structured Data (JSON-LD): Utilizing machine-readable markup helps AI models categorize content more accurately, facilitating easier extraction of key facts.
- Multi-Platform Authority: Consistency across multiple channels, including LinkedIn, YouTube, and specialized forums, reinforces the perception of the content creator as an authority in the eyes of the AI.
- Freshness Signals: Explicitly dating content and providing current information ensures that AI models favor the source over outdated alternatives.
- Format Clarity: Using tables, bullet points, and numbered lists allows LLMs to parse and synthesize complex information more efficiently than dense, long-form paragraphs.
Measurement and Tracking Challenges
One of the primary obstacles for digital marketers is the lack of native analytics for AI-generated traffic. Unlike Google Search Console, which provides granular data on impressions and clicks, AI platforms do not currently offer standardized performance reports for website owners.
To bridge this gap, businesses are increasingly turning to third-party tools such as Ahrefs, SE Ranking, and Keyword.com, which monitor how often specific domains appear in AI-generated answers. For smaller organizations, cost-effective solutions include using no-code automation platforms like Make.com to systematically test queries and track citation frequency. This transition from "blind" publishing to data-driven AIO allows for iterative improvements, where creators can refine their content based on real-time visibility metrics.
Broader Industry Implications and Future Outlook
The shift toward AI-mediated discovery has profound implications for digital marketing budgets and labor. As competition for the top spot in an AI response increases, the "winner-take-all" nature of AI summaries may force a decline in traffic to lower-ranked websites. Conversely, the traffic that does reach a site from an AI citation is often more highly qualified, as the user has already been primed by the AI’s summary of the content’s value.
Looking ahead, industry analysts suggest that AI search will continue to evolve toward higher levels of personalization. Models will eventually learn to tailor answers based on the individual user’s history and preferences, which could lead to a fragmentation of search results. For organizations, this means that establishing a distinct, recognizable brand perspective will become as important as technical optimization.
Furthermore, the legal landscape surrounding AI training and attribution remains in flux. While platforms like Perplexity and Google have begun implementing citation features, the question of whether publishers should be compensated for the training data their content provides remains a subject of intense debate in legal and legislative circles.
